The S-80725AL-AN-T1 is a voltage detector manufactured by SII Semiconductor Corporation. Voltage detectors are critical components in electronic circuits, tasked with monitoring the supply voltage and triggering a reset signal when it falls below a predetermined level. This functionality is vital for ensuring the correct operation of microcontrollers, CPUs, and other sensitive digital circuitry, preventing data corruption and system malfunctions that can occur due to undervoltage conditions.

Additional Details
The S-80725AL-AN-T1 has a detection voltage of 2.5V. The output type is N-channel open drain. The "-AN-T1" likely refers to specific packaging and taping specifications for automated assembly. The operating temperature range is typically -40°C to +85°C.
